What Is the Cat Palm Plant?
Understanding the Context
The Cat Palm, formally known as Chamaedorea cataractarum, is a small, slow-growing palm native to the rainforests of southern Mexico and Guatemala. Often referred to as the Cat Palm, it belongs to the Arecaceae (palm) family but is much stubbier and more compact than towering rainforest palms. Standing between 2 to 4 feet tall, it features feathery, arching fronds that give it an elegant, tropical look.
Despite its name, the Cat Palm is not toxic to cats — a relief for pet owners worried about harmful plants. With proper care, it can thrive indoors for years, making it an excellent choice for households with active cats.

Light & Location
The Cat Palm prefers bright, indirect light, making it perfect for locations near windows or in well-lit rooms. Unlike many flowering indoor plants, it doesn’t require intense sunshine, which reduces the risk of leaf scorching. Place it near a north- or east-facing window for optimal growth.

Temperature & Humidity
This palm thrives in moderate indoor temperatures (65–80°F) and benefits from occasional misting or placement near a humidifier — especially in drier climates or winters. While it adapts well to average home humidity, occasional oversight in moisture can help maintain lush, vibrant fronds.
Watering & Soil Needs
Water your Cat Palm when the top inch of soil feels dry — typically every 1–2 weeks, depending on humidity and pot size. Use a well-draining, organic potting mix designed for palms or tropical plants. Overwatering risks root rot, so ensure your pot has drainage holes.
Cat-Friendly Benefits of the Cat Palm
- Safe for Curious Cats: Unlike many common houseplants (e.g., lilies, philodendrons), the Cat Palm poses no toxicity risk. Curious cats can explore the plant without worry.
- Self-Cleaning Aesthetic: Its graceful fronds add natural beauty without sharp edges or toxic sap, making it hazard-free for households with pets.
- Air-Purifying Qualities: Like many indoor palms, it gently filters air, absorbing carbon dioxide and releasing oxygen—beneficial for both humans and cats.

- Fertilizing: Use a balanced, diluted liquid fertilizer every 4–6 weeks during spring and summer, reducing or pausing feeding in fall and winter.
- Pruning: Trim only brown or dead fronds at the base to maintain appeal and encourage new growth.
- Pest Prevention: Keep an eye out for spider mites or aphids; Washing leaves regularly helps deter infestations.
